Introduction
Ad scheduling, also known as dayparting, refers to the process of selecting specific times of the day, days of the week, and months to display your pay-per-click (PPC) ads. Ad scheduling is a crucial component of any ecommerce PPC campaign. It can help you save money, increase conversion rates, and improve the overall performance of your campaigns. Advantages of Ad Scheduling
There are many reasons why you should consider ad scheduling in your ecommerce PPC campaigns. Here are some of the benefits of ad scheduling:
Cost Savings
Ad scheduling can help you save money on your PPC campaigns. By scheduling your ads to appear during times of the day when your target audience is most active, you can avoid wasting ad spend on times when no one is searching for your products. This means you can maximize your budget and get the most for your money.
Increased Conversion Rates
Ad scheduling can also help you increase conversion rates. By displaying your ads during times when your target audience is most likely to be online and searching for your products, you can increase the chances of them clicking on your ads and making a purchase. This means you can get more conversions with the same amount of traffic.
Improved Performance
By analyzing your PPC campaign data, you can determine which times of the day, days of the week, and months are most effective for your ecommerce PPC campaigns. Ad scheduling allows you to take this data and adjust your campaigns accordingly. This can help you improve the overall performance of your campaigns and achieve better results.
How to Implement Ad Scheduling
To implement ad scheduling, you need to follow these steps:
Step 1: Analyze Your Data
The first step in implementing ad scheduling is to analyze your PPC campaign data. Look for patterns in your data such as which times of the day, days of the week, and months are most effective for your campaigns. Use this data to determine when to schedule your ads.
Step 2: Create Your Schedule
Once you have analyzed your data, create a schedule for your PPC ads. This can be done using the scheduling feature in your PPC platform. Select the times of the day, days of the week, and months when you want your ads to appear.
Step 3: Monitor Your Campaigns
After you have implemented ad scheduling, monitor your campaigns regularly. Analyze your data to see how your campaigns are performing during different times of the day, days of the week, and months. Use this data to make adjustments to your scheduling as needed.
Best Practices for Ad Scheduling
To get the most out of ad scheduling, you need to follow these best practices:
Tip 1: Know Your Audience
Before implementing ad scheduling, you need to understand your audience. Analyze your data to determine when your target audience is most active and searching for products similar to yours. Use this data to schedule your ads during these times.
Tip 2: Test Different Schedules
Don’t be afraid to test different scheduling options. Try scheduling your ads at different times of the day, days of the week, and months. Analyze the data to see which schedules are most effective for your campaigns.
Tip 3: Adjust Your Bids
When scheduling your ads, remember to adjust your bids accordingly. Bid higher during times when you expect more competition and lower during times when there is less competition. This can help you maximize your budget and get the most for your money.
